Chawane
Chawane is a village located in Panvel tehsil of Raigarh district in Maharashtra, India. It is situated 23km away from sub-district headquarter Panvel (tehsildar office) and 63km away from district headquarter Alibag. As per 2009 stats, Chawane village is also a gram panchayat.

About Chawane
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Chawane is 553508. The village spans a total geographical area of 508.19 hectares. Panvel is nearest town to Chawane village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 18km away.
When it comes to local governance, Chawane village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Uran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Maval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Chawane
According to the 2011 Census, Chawane has a total population of about 693, with approximately 349 males and 344 females. The sex ratio is around 985 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 88 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. Details about the Scheduled Castes (SC) community are not available.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 191. The overall literacy rate is approximately 60.03%, with male literacy at about 67.05% and female literacy near 52.91%. There are around 163 households in the village. Together, these details offer a clear picture of Chawane's population size, gender balance, young residents, literacy levels, and social makeup.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 693 | 349 | 344 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 88 | 47 | 41 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 191 | 94 | 97 |
Literate Population | 416 | 234 | 182 |
Illiterate Population | 277 | 115 | 162 |
Connectivity of Chawane
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Chawane. As per the 2011 stats, Chawane had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
